[arch-commits] Commit in cinnamon-desktop/trunk (PKGBUILD)

Alexandre Filgueira faidoc at archlinux.org
Wed Jun 3 15:34:54 UTC 2015


    Date: Wednesday, June 3, 2015 @ 17:34:53
  Author: faidoc
Revision: 134697

upgpkg: cinnamon-desktop 2.6.4-2

Modified:
  cinnamon-desktop/trunk/PKGBUILD

----------+
 PKGBUILD |   11 ++++++-----
 1 file changed, 6 insertions(+), 5 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2015-06-03 15:22:54 UTC (rev 134696)
+++ PKGBUILD	2015-06-03 15:34:53 UTC (rev 134697)
@@ -4,7 +4,7 @@
 
 pkgname=cinnamon-desktop
 pkgver=2.6.4
-pkgrel=1
+pkgrel=2
 pkgdesc="Library with common API for various Cinnamon modules"
 arch=(i686 x86_64)
 license=(GPL LGPL)
@@ -21,6 +21,10 @@
   cd $pkgname-$pkgver
   # Update configuration for GNOME 3.14
   patch -Np1 -i ../gnome-3.14.patch
+  # Arch uses systemd
+  sed -i 's|false|true|g' schemas/org.cinnamon.desktop.session.gschema.xml.in.in
+  # Fix build failure 
+  sed -i 's|subdir-objects||g' configure.ac
 }
 
 build() {
@@ -27,10 +31,7 @@
   cd $pkgname-$pkgver
   ./autogen.sh --prefix=/usr --sysconfdir=/etc --localstatedir=/var \
     --libexecdir=/usr/lib/$pkgname --disable-static
-    
-  # Workaround for make error until it is fixed upstream
-  cd libcinnamon-desktop/libgsystem && ln -sr '../$(libgsystem_srcpath)/.deps' .deps
-  cd ../../
+
   make
 }
 



More information about the arch-commits mailing list